Event description

Employee fractures ribs when pinned by paper roll

Investigation abstract

An employee was preparing a 1,100-pound roll to put in the press machine at prep station 1. At 9:20 a.m. on January 5, 2022, the employee was injured, when he got caught between the 1,100-pound roll of paper that was coming down a conveyer system and a four foot safety stanchion pole. The employee suffered broken ribs. The employee was first transported to Kaiser hospital in Fremont and then transported to Eden Hospital in Castro Valley, where he was hospitalized.
